"Discusses guidelines for assessing a client's risk of suicide: predisposing factors, physical and psychological health factors. Includes a simulated intake interview that demonstrates a useful approach to take when interviewing a suicidal individual. After the interview, the features of the case are presented and a rationale for making a decision and taking action is provided. Reviews basic clinical interviewing skills."
